The Coastal Vulnerability and Risk Assessment activity is a pilot component involving three countries, Barbados, Grenada, and Guyana. This component will involve a review of coastal vulnerability assessment models and the application of the IPCC common methodology in the three countries and throughout the region. With the execution of the three vulnerability and risk assessments, there will be technology transfer though training and information dissemination. Specifically, results will be presented through a regional workshop presenting the results of the three case studies and manuals will be prepared for the execution of coastal vulnerability and risk assessments.
